W Hotels Worldwide Announces Renovation Of Its Sublime W San Diego Property

By Pardhasaradhi Gonuguntla

NEW YORK – W Hotels Worldwide today announced the completed renovation of its sun-soaked W San Diego property by design guru and style icon, Thom Filicia. W San Diego underwent a transformation with the complete redesign of the property’s Living Room lounge, WET pool deck and Veranda poolside bar. Living Room at W San Diego

Living Room has been transformed into a fresh new space for guests, creating a welcoming and stylish social atmosphere. Multifunctional seating areas allow guests to lounge in luxury, take advantage of complimentary wireless Internet access, peruse through the hotel’s intriguing reading selections, enjoy delectable delights, and sip cocktails with friends at the chic new Living Room bar. Warm and cool color tones ebb and flow throughout the space creating a serene and modern beach-like atmosphere infused with high design.

The space transforms from day to night, as a DJ spins sounds for chilling from an eye-in-the sky DJ booth. Three immense floating light fixtures illuminate Living Room, bringing a sun soaked glow to the space. Wood-louvered indoor cabanas allow guests to recline in intimate privacy, while comfortable and stylish table seating enables travelers to conduct business if needed. LCD panels above the cabanas and behind the Welcome Desk play vintage surf footage of San Diego beaches. A sophisticated and whimsical installation of surfboard fins exhibited on the grand wall of Living Room serve as a monument to Southern California surf culture. The design honors San Diego’s seaside history with a fresh spin on So-Cal chic.

Veranda Bar and WET

The renovation of W San Diego’s second floor bar Veranda, and connecting outdoor swimming pool WET, continue to enhance the guest’s experience with seamless chic modernity. As they travel through the indoor-outdoor space, guests will feel renewed by the cool blue ocean hues, sleek and stylish furniture, and the fresh breeze drifting inside. Filicia and W’s design team have transformed Veranda and WET into an alluring oasis for travelers. Veranda has been redesigned to accommodate more guests with low bungalow seating that wraps around the indoor wall. Two stunning coral chandeliers illuminate the space, as blue and white design elements give the lounge a nautical feel. Veranda’s bar features whimsical and decorative 1950’s surfboard inspirations, and serves delicious cocktails day and night.

At WET, guests can recline on chaise lounges by the pool, soaking in the sun, while enjoying cocktails and nibbles from Veranda. WET features new highlights such as a stunning wall of mirrors, whimsical botanicals, and a dramatic hyper photo of a wave appearing to crest.

Beach Rooftop Bar—COMING IN ’09!

Beach— the first ever rooftop bar in San Diego with a fire pit, cabana service and three tons of heated sand—will also be designed by Filicia and is expected to launch in early 2009. W’s design team and Filicia have created a fresh, edgy, and whimsical atmosphere where surf is art, and relaxing is key. The rooftop outdoor redesign will accommodate more guests with an extended wooden deck, the addition of a second bar, expanded seating environments, more cabanas, and new design elements that are full of vibrant color and heart. The deck will be enlarged to cover more ground space, enabling guest to have easy access to the two bars and five cabanas.

Two of the new cabanas will be freestanding seating pods painted in bright colors. They are inspired by old surf vans, made modern with a chic W twist. The bars will be designed with a special curve referencing the shape of a wave and the movement of the ocean. A fire pit will be surrounded by ottoman seating covered in colorful outdoor fabric reminiscent of woven hammocks and the feeling of leisurely afternoons. There will be two vintage seahorse rockers installed in the sand to add an element of playful whimsy, along with driftwood tables and oversized planters. The remaining three connecting cabanas have been transformed into chic lounging dens, with flowing white fabric and louvered wooded walls. There will be a sky platform on top of the middle cabana to allow guests an extra perch and view of the outdoor cityscape. Lush green plants will enliven the space and add pops of green against the blue sky. Beach will be revealed in early 2009, giving worldwide travelers and San Diego locals a place to get away and relax in sophisticated comfort.
